- Enfinity Global secured grid connectivity for 2 GW of solar and wind projects in India. What were the key factors in site selection, and what impact will these projects have on Indiaโs renewable sector?
Securing grid connectivity for 2 GW of renewable projects is a significant milestone. Our approach to site selection is driven by our long-term perspective and targeted to achieve an overarching objective of lowest risk-adjusted LCOE; including a combination of factors like resource availability, speed of execution, market competitiveness, market maturity, and regulatory landscape.
From an industry perspective, grid interconnections remain a challenge due to network limitations. While India is making commendable progress in expanding its green energy corridor, the process takes time. Most new capacity is expected to be online post-2027, but our projects will be operational by 2026-27, ensuring a timely contribution to Indiaโs 2030 renewable energy targets.
These projects will provide reliable, cost-effective clean energy to industries such as manufacturing, data centers, automotive, steel, and pharmaceuticals, supporting their decarbonization goals. By delivering clean power at scale, Enfinity Global is playing a critical role in strengthening Indiaโs renewable energy ecosystem and driving the transition toward a more sustainable future.

- How is Enfinity adopting advanced solar technologies to improve efficiency and sustainability in its Indian projects? Any specific innovations?
A key differentiator is our advanced global asset management platform, which leverages AI-driven analytics to monitor performance at every levelโfrom individual devices to entire plants. This enables proactive event management, allowing us to identify underperformance trends and optimize efficiency through predictive analytics.
Also, we are advancing towards Digital Twin technology, an AI-powered solution that enhances fault detection with geographic precision. This system provides real-time diagnostics on equipment health, reducing downtime and improving operational reliability.

- How do Indiaโs policies on domestic manufacturing and import reduction affect Enfinity Globalโs operations? What is your view on the current regulatory landscape?
Indiaโs push for domestic manufacturing and reduced import dependence is a positive step toward building a self-sufficient, resilient, and competitive renewable energy ecosystem, providing energy security while putting pressure on foreign exchange. Policies such as the Production-Linked Incentive (PLI) scheme, Basic Customs Duty (BCD) on solar modules, and ALMM regulations are aimed at strengthening local supply chains. We see this leading to a resilient domestic market that is better equipped to fight global supply shocks.
For Enfinity Global, these policies reinforce our long-term investment strategy in India. While they do present short-term supply chain-related challenges with respect to deliveries, cost, and quality, they also create opportunities for collaboration with local partners. Further, our ability to aggregate demand from other geographies and competence around product understanding coupled with long-standing global relationships allow us to foster deep and long-term collaboration with local partners and an opportunity to deliver superior performance. The regulatory landscape is evolving, and India has taken significant steps to facilitate large-scale renewable deployment. However, ensuring predictability, ease of execution, and a stable policy environment is crucial for attracting continued investment and scaling up renewable capacity.
